Cannot add default Flare Layer component to a Camera from code
To reproduce:
1. Generate code that creates a camera; i.e. Camera someCam;
2. Generate code to add a flare layer component; i.e. someCam.gameObject.AddComponent<FlareLayer>();
Expected result:
Ability to add all default camera components via code.
Actual result:
You cannot. Flare Layer does not exist as a class / type.
Side problem:
As there isn't a C# version of FlareLayer class that the Camera depends on, this will get stripped from iOS builds if not used in a scene and crash on Light::RemoveFromManager.
